    Hi Myron,
    Thank you. I've been looking at some options to bulk import transactions and got stuck on these:

    1 . Wave connect does not appear to feature import of category (for bank statement upload). I need this to migrate.

    2. Wave connect journal import only imports one journal date at a time. I need to bulk import a year.

    3. Wave API mutate handle does not appear to offer transaction import. If it does then I can use the API instead of 1 & 2 above.

    If I'm missing something please let me know as I'm keen to get data migrated asap. Or if there are other methods please advise.

    Thanks again

    Hi @xenium . You're actually correct with all of these statements.
    First, Wave Connect does not let you import the category. This is definitely something that the team is aware of as we've had users point it out a couple of time, but I'll make sure to let them know that it's being pointed out again.
    Next, Wave Connect does only import one journal at a time. I believe this is because a journal can be so complex that we only allow for one to be imported at a time. Additionally I would say that the thought is there are also only so many Journals that a user typically has, although you've shown that this isn't always the case.
    Lastly, our APIs are currently a tad limited but we'll be working in the future to expand them. This was a project that was briefly put on hold, but we're hoping that in the future we can really grow it to offer more options.
